Australia has a handful of icons that are instantly recognisable. Uluru, kangaroos and koalas, the Opera House, Hugh Jackman, the Sydney Harbour Bridge (affectionately known as the coathanger.) This weekend just passed saw Sydney, a city that just loves an excuse to party, celebrating the bridge's
75th Anniversary. Hundreds of thousands walked the bridge (see picture) and after sunset watched a cool light show from vantage points around the harbour. No fireworks this time, a good call since they've been done already this year for New Year's and Australia Day. Apparently a crowd of 750,000 turned out for the opening 75 years ago. Now THAT'S a party!
